A home warranty is a protection plan that helps Altoona homeowners cut the expenses of appliance and system repairs. The plans offer coverage to fix or replace appliances and systems that break down due to normal wear and tear. When something breaks down, you file a claim and pay a service fee. The home warranty provider then finds a contractor to handle the fix or replacement. Homeowners may have out-of-pocket costs only if the cost of repair or replacement goes over the item's coverage limit. A home warranty gives homeowners peace of mind by helping avoid high-priced emergency repairs. The coverage is especially helpful for those living in older houses or houses with fixtures near the end of their life span. However, homeowners with newer homes and functioning appliances may not require a home warranty.
Home warranties cover many household systems and appliances. Common covered appliances include washers, microwaves, dryers, garbage disposals, dishwashers, refrigerators, and others. Covered systems include air conditioning, heating, electrical, and plumbing. Many home warranty plans offer additional coverage for roof leaks, central vacuums, septic systems, and even locksmiths. Most home warranty plans require Altoona homeowners to refrain from making claims for 30 days before the plan will cover repairs. Additionally, policies typically only cover repairs and replacements resulting from normal wear and tear. Home warranties don't cover cosmetic issues, natural disasters, pre-existing conditions, or misuse of a system or appliance. When you're deciding on a home warranty provider, there are several key things to take into account:
Home warranty coverage varies widely in the items that are included. Most plans include protection for AC, heating, plumbing, electrical, and appliances. More comprehensive plans also cover other items such as spas, roof leaks, pools, and well pumps. Focus on companies with broad coverage options including upgraded plans. Flexibility like this will help you customize your plan to meet your needs.
You'll pay a service fee, typically $60–100, for each claim filed with your home warranty provider. These fees to accumulate quickly with each claim, so you may look for companies advertising lower service fees to optimize savings on each repair claim. Certain providers may eliminate deductibles after a customer goes a period of time with no claims filed.
A home warranty company's track record gives you insight into things such as claim approval rates, timeliness of repairs, contractor quality, and overall customer satisfaction. Use third-party review sites such as the Better Business Bureau (BBB), TrustPilot, or Google Reviews to research providers. Positive reviews and ratings indicate a provider known for stellar service.
Home warranty providers keep networks of local technicians to handle repairs in your area. Contact potential providers to find out how many repair professionals they have in Altoona and get an idea for how fast your repairs might happen in an emergency situation. Wider networks raise the probability of getting qualified contractors to swiftly service your home.

Home warranties also have some drawbacks. Although it can save you time when the home warranty sends out a service technician who takes care of the repair for you, some homeowners may not like this, and they would rather choose their own contractor. If that’s the case for you, some home warranty companies let you select a contractor.
Another stipulation is that home warranties typically only cover repairs needed due to normal wear and tear. They most likely won’t cover home systems or appliances that have been damaged due to improper maintenance, natural disasters, animal infestations, etc.
A home warranty plan costs, on average, around $300 to $600 a year in Altoona. Our top-rated home warranty companies' most comprehensive coverage options vary from $546 to $840 per year. You can get a lower monthly payment with some companies by choosing a higher service fee. Additionally, it's typically cheaper to pay annually rather than monthly.
Home warranties and home insurance differ in what types of damage they cover. Home warranties cover issues related to systems and appliances that need repairs or replacements due to normal wear and tear. A home insurance policy is a different kind of plan that protects an entire home from natural disasters, which can sometimes be a concern in Altoona. It doesn't cover a normal appliance or system damage.

A home warranty plan will cover your appliances, systems, or both. Combination plans are great if you'd like more coverage for your home, but a system- or appliance-only plan can be helpful if you're concerned about one more than the other.
Generally, a home warranty policy offers coverage for a year and can be renewed annually. Some companies may offer month-to-month plans.
Typically, the homeowner pays for the home warranty. In some cases, though, the person who is selling the home may buy a home warranty and transfer the policy to the buyer. The new homeowner will then be responsible for the service fees when using the policy.
